Climate
About 19°C by day and 8°C at night all year, wettest in April–May and October–November, and almost no building has heating.

The essentials at a glance

Detail🇮🇩 Bali🇨🇴 Bogotá
Population~4.4 million (island of Bali)≈8 million in the Distrito Capital; ≈11 million across the Bogotá region
Official languageIndonesian (Balinese spoken locally; English in tourist areas)Spanish, in a formal highland accent that uses 'usted' far more than the coast or Medellín
CurrencyIndonesian Rupiah (IDR)Colombian peso (COP)
Time zoneWITA (GMT+8)COT (GMT−5), no daylight saving — so the offset to New York changes twice a year, not Bogotá's clock
Power plugTypes C/F, 230VTypes A and B, 110 V / 60 Hz — identical to the United States
ReligionBalinese Hindu (unique in Muslim-majority Indonesia)
Altitude2,640 m — high enough that altitude sickness is a normal first-week experience
ClimateCool and cloudy year-round: about 19°C by day, 7–9°C at night, wetter in April–May and October–November. No heating in most buildings
AddressesCalles run east–west, Carreras north–south; the mountains are always east
